Alcohol involved in crash southwest of Kirksville

Local News March 24, 2018 KTTN News

Two northeast Missouri residents received minor injuries when a pickup truck went off a road and hit a utility pole southwest of Kirksville late Friday night. The driver, 25-year-old Harold Coy of Brashear, and a passenger, 24-year-old Matthew Whitten of Kirksville, refused treatment at the scene.
